The probe thermocouple type k is made by directly welding one end of the thermocouple wire into a temperature measurement point and placing it in a 304 stainless steel protective tube as a probe rod, and the other end is directly extended to the required length as a lead wire. It is usually used in conjunction with display instruments, recording tables, electronic regulators, etc., and is mainly used to measure the temperature of solid surfaces or pure gases. The sensor has the advantages of good linearity, large thermal electromotive force, high sensitivity and fast response speed. Thermocouples with the same scale can use different types of thermocouple wire, but the temperature measurement range of the thermocouple may be different. Stainless steel braided wire probe type K thermocouples are typically used for environmental measurements from 0 to 250 degrees Celsius. Silicone wire probe type K thermocouple is usually used for environmental measurements between 0-200 degrees Celsius.

Features of probe thermocouple type k

 

1. It has good linearity and can accurately reflect temperature changes.

2. The thermal electromotive force is large and can generate a large electromotive force signal, which is convenient for subsequent processing and measurement.

3. It has high sensitivity and can quickly respond to temperature changes, improving the accuracy and stability of measurement.

4. It has good stability and uniformity and can maintain stable measurement performance for a long time.

5. The price is relatively low, has high cost performance, and is suitable for large-scale applications.

6. The length of the probe can be customized according to the needs of the application scenario.

 

FAQ

 

Q: Instructions of probe thermocouple type k

A: The thermocouple should not be installed too close to the door or heating place, and the insertion depth should be at least 8 to 10 times the diameter of the protective tube; the gap between the protective tube of the thermocouple and the wall is not filled with insulating material, causing heat to overflow or cool down in the furnace. Air invades, so the gap between the thermocouple protection tube and the furnace wall hole should be blocked with insulating materials such as refractory mud or asbestos rope to prevent hot and cold air convection from affecting the accuracy of temperature measurement; the cold end of the thermocouple is too close to the furnace body, causing the temperature to exceed 100℃; The installation of thermocouples should avoid strong magnetic fields and strong electric fields as much as possible, so thermocouples and power cables should not be installed in the same conduit to avoid interference and errors; thermocouples cannot be installed where the measured medium rarely flows. In an area where a thermocouple is used to measure the gas temperature in the tube, the thermocouple must be installed against the direction of flow and fully in contact with the gas.

 

Q: Precautions for use on probe thermocouple type k

A: When connecting a long thermocouple wire, be sure to use a compensating wire.
Be sure to observe the heat-resistant temperature of each part stated on each product page. Please note that even if the upper temperature limit of temperature measurement is high, if it exceeds the heat-resistant temperature, it may cause malfunctions such as disconnection.
Do not apply large external force or vibration.
The upper limit temperature of the measurement should not exceed the temperature measurement range of the product. If the casing temperature exceeds the heat-resistant temperature, it will easily cause the temperature measurement line to break.
